Output 9759a9a2d860aed8bcd4054474bf33dbfe37f603b93eddce18525586fb5529e2:1

value
142655446
script pubkey
OP_0 OP_PUSHBYTES_20 3f739d41ecd659a5cf331d3b5bda140cf5942b2e
address
bc1q8aee6s0v6ev6tnenr5a4hks5pn6eg2ew7lpk84
transaction
9759a9a2d860aed8bcd4054474bf33dbfe37f603b93eddce18525586fb5529e2
confirmations
128216
spent
true